About one in three patients who undergo open-heart surgery develop an irregular heart rhythm called postoperative atrial fibrillation (POAF). This condition increases the risk of stroke, prolongs hospital stays, and raises the chances of complications and death compared with patients who do not develop it. Because of these serious outcomes, researchers are working to identify which patients are most at risk. One potential blood marker is lipoprotein(a), or Lp(a). Higher levels of Lp(a) have been linked to abnormal heart rhythms in previous studies. We want to determine whether patients with elevated Lp(a) are more likely to develop POAF after heart surgery and better understand the biological mechanisms behind this risk. In this study, patients will be grouped based on whether they have high or low Lp(a) levels. All participants will wear a chest band monitor that continuously tracks heart rhythm for 3 months after surgery to detect POAF. During surgery, small tissue samples from the heart will also be collected. By examining these samples, we will assess whether patients with elevated Lp(a) show more scarring and inflammation which are two pathways known to cause abnormal heart rhythms. The goal of this study is to determine whether elevated Lp(a) increases susceptibility to POAF. This could help identify patients who may benefit from preventive treatments and closer monitoring. By understanding how Lp(a) affects heart tissue, we also hope to uncover the mechanisms that contribute to abnormal rhythm and guide the development of future targeted therapies to treat POAF and other heart rhythms.
